Introducing the latest creation of Steve Kozloff Designs--Epiphany, a 178’ mega yacht trimaran. Epiphany has three decks, is a double masted sailing craft with two Solid Sail systems from Chantiers de l’Atlantique Solid Sail/ AeolDrive sail and mast system.
Epiphanys’ One-of-a-kind features
Internal garage for an A5 Icon seaplane.
1500 sq ft interconnecting retractable beach club.
An integrated telescoping crane system in the boom of each mast that can load and off-load provisions, tenders, seaplanes, and more.
1 large stern pool.
Forward viewing windows in the hulls.
She is equipped with four self-inflating lifeboats that can be deployed in the worst conditions from her dedicated deployment pockets at her stern.
Epiphanys’ interior space
The interior space has multi-levels, curved walls, and a multitude of large windows providing a near panoramic view.
Shefeatures a 700 ft² owner’s suite located in the bow of the center hull and in the cross beam are 2 master suites. Guest cabins can host 12 guests in full luxury, and crew cabins accommodate 8 crew.
The piano and entertainment (salon) area are on the upper deck include floor to ceiling windows providing views of the surrounding seascape. The bar is elevated two steps up from the piano providing unique and inviting spaces.
Advantages of the Solid Sail System
Epiphany with her Solid Sail system has many great advantages over traditional sailing rigs. Five of those advantages are listed below.
The mast tilts 70 degrees forward to reduce the air draft from 145.5 feet to 92 feet making it possible for Epiphany to traverse below most bridges. Epiphany now can have direct access to the Panama Canal, San Francisco, San Diego, and many more notable harbors.
Solid Sail system is the automated setting and dropping of the sails.
The boat can be pointed in any direction when raising or lowering of the sails. The Solid Sail System has a 360-degree rotating mast. The captain simply rotates the mast into the wind to preform the raising and lowering of the sails.
Solid Sail material has a 20 plus year service life vs 4 to 5 years for traditional Dacron sails.
The free-standing mast is clean and free of yards and shrouds, thus making voyages into icing conditions much more practical and safer. Introducing a de-icing system to the clean mast is very feasible.
The Solid Sail system has integrated load sensing technology that informs the captain how much to drive the sailing rigs.
The main sail on each mast is comprised of semi rigid panels that are hinged together. The jib is a traditional Dacron sail that is automatically rolled in or out.
The Solid Sail system is significantly less expensive than other free-standing sail rig systems.

Epiphanys’ performance
She can cruise at 10kts for 4800 nautical miles with diesel power only. Her range is greatly extended with careful management of her hybrid diesel-electric systems and sail power. Under sail power only, she can make 8kts.
Epiphanys’ anchor system
The traditional external anchor system has been replaced with an unusual flush mounted submarine style anchor underneath the bow. This system offers a cleaner bow appearance.
